Getty Images. In a breakthrough, Australian scientists found two fungi that can break down plastics in 140 days. It was the "highest degradation rate reported" worldwide, scientists at the University of Sydney said. Brandon et al. (2018) ... Brunner et al. (2018) isolated more than a hundred fungal species from plastic debris floating in the shoreline and investigated their ability to degraded PE and PU. None of these strains was able to degraded PE.

A group of researchers from the University of Sydney have successfully biodegraded a commonly used and hard-to-recycle plastic, called Polypropylene, using two strains of fungi.
